I totally disagree with Farage and his ideas, but it cannot be considered that "the two dictatorships have disappeared thanks to the European Union". Even in consideration of the important role of the EU in international relations, Tajani's statement was too simplistic and untrue compared to the complexity of the events that led to the end of the two dictatorships. On the other hand, the EU was officially born with the Maastricht Treaty of 1992, while the European Economic Community (EEC) with the Treaty of Rome of 25 March 1957. Both had little to do with Nazism, considering the inexorable decline with the end of the Second World War (1945) and the indispensable intervention of the United States. A completely marginal role also in the dissolution of the USSR. We agree on respect for opinions, but the story must be told objectively. And I say this as an Italian and a pro-European.

Reading some of the comments, I realise there seems to be a misunderstanding. Mr. Tajani said the EU helped defeat the dictatorships of the 20th century: that is, for the most part, not factually true (the EU was born after the fall of nazi germany and the end of world war 2 and while I can see where he is coming from when he talks about communism in eastern Europe, it seems to me that the causes for the fall of the eastern block are a lot more nuanced). That said, I think the validity of the message still stands: the EU has defeated fascism, national socialism and communism because it has been able to marginalize nationalism and authoritarian ideals by creating a sense of common identity between european nations (which is sadly being slowly eroded by buffoons like Orban and, in a less human-rights-violating way, Farage and Johnson). Europe has never known a longer period of continuous peace and relative prosperity for the entirety of it's history and while other factors may have contributed to this outcome, the existence of the EU is certainly prominent among them. That is just my opinion and, while i cannot read in Tajani's mind, I think that is what he meant.
